JW v Canada (AG) : The Judiciary’s Role in Supervising Residential School Settlement Agreements

Introduction Certain class action lawsuits require settlement agreements to ensure the fair distribution of settlement funds through an adjudicative process. An Independent Assessment Process (“IAP”) provides for an independent adjudicator to determine the validity of disputed claims.
